Frazer Invited To Financial Services Regulatory Forum at the Harvard Club

On June 25, at the invitation of the ABA’s New York White Collar Crime Committee, Frazer joined more than 120 high profile guests for a speech by Benjamin Lawsky, The New York State Superintendent of Financial Services, followed by a panel discussion and cocktails. The event was co-sponsored by the ABA, Duff & Phelps, and CDS.

Among other issues, Frazer engaged Mr. Lawsky in a spirited dialogue about the pros and cons of New York banks being overseen by multiple regulators and whether the current system might prove unduly burdensome, particularly for smaller financial institutions.
